Call For Paper

The (ICOTES) is dedicated to advancing research excellence by bringing together leading scholars, scientists, and professionals from across the globe. It provides a platform for the dissemination of high-quality research and innovative methodologies.

With a strong focus on Surgery,Otolaryngology, the conference promotes research that contributes to academic depth, practical insights, and interdisciplinary knowledge integration.

Authors are invited to submit papers addressing, but not limited to, the following areas:

01
Advancements in otolaryngology surgical techniques
02
Management of chronic sinusitis in adults
03
Pediatric otolaryngology: challenges and solutions
04
Innovations in hearing restoration methods
05
Ethics in ENT surgical practices
06
Surgical management of head and neck cancers
07
Telemedicine in otolaryngology care
08
Quality of life after ENT surgery
09
Role of imaging in ENT diagnostics
10
Patient safety in otolaryngology procedures
11
Challenges in managing sleep apnea
12
Surgical interventions for voice disorders
13
Impact of allergies on ENT health
14
Interdisciplinary approaches in ENT care
15
Long-term outcomes in otolaryngology patients
16
Innovative treatments for tinnitus management
17
Global health issues in ENT surgery
18
Education and training in otolaryngology
19
Future trends in ENT surgery
20
Psychosocial aspects of ENT disorders
